What you’ll be doing…
Develop and execute comprehensive test plans, test cases, and test scripts for functional, regression, integration, performance, and automated testing.
Design, develop, and maintain scalable automated test frameworks using JavaScript (ES6+), Node.js, and Playwright, Selenium, TestCafe or others.
Implement and maintain UI, API, and end-to-end automated test suites across web applications and services.
Identify, document, and track defects, collaborating with development teams to resolve issues efficiently.
BDD Framework Implementation: Utilize Behavior-Driven Development (BDD) frameworks such as Cucumber to enhance test automation using Gherkin syntax.
Quality Assurance Leadership: Provide technical guidance on best practices for testing, automation strategy, and quality engineering standards.
Conduct manual and automated testing to verify software and hardware functionality.
Analyze test results, generate reports, and provide recommendations for product improvements.
Work closely with development, product management, and QA teams to define testing requirements and acceptance criteria.
Assist in troubleshooting and debugging issues in various environments.
Continuously explore new testing tools, techniques, and methodologies to improve automation coverage and testing effectiveness.
Maintain QA on code bases written in Python, PHP, JavaScript, and Node.js.
Collaborate with cross-functional teams (developers, product managers, UX designers) to understand requirements, define testing scope, and maintain quality standards.
Identify, document, and track issues through resolution using industry-standard defect tracking tools.
Establish test metrics, KPIs, and quality benchmarks, regularly reporting on quality status, trends, and risks to stakeholders.
Integrate automated test suites into CI/CD pipelines using tools such as Jenkins, GitLab CI, or Azure DevOps.
